Lauren Mascitti is back with another incredible “American Idol” performance in a new preview clip.
Mascitti takes a risk as she belts out her original solo song “God Made A Woman”, dedicated to her supportive nana.
The VT before the performance follows Mascitti and her grandmother as they look back through old photographs and video footage, before the pair head to Hollywood.

Arthur Gunn got the judges fired up Sunday night on American Idol with a bold performance of a Bob Marley classic.“I really didn’t expect that I’d be this far. I’m still trying to grasp it all,” the Kathmandu, Nepal-born singer and guitarist said during his piece-to-camera.He’s still got a ways to go.Performing “one for the Rastafarian,” Gunn put his own spin on Bob Marley and the Wailers’ “Is this Love”.
